|
PXIe-1491和PXIe-6545/2172采集原始数字视频时通过PXIe背板传输未压缩数据。背板传输数据和控制器处理数据的过程都非常耗费带宽,因此了解不同数字视频分辨率所需的带宽和其对应用程序的影响十分重要。
表1列出了各种常见数字视频分辨率所需的带宽。如使用的分辨率未在表中列出或需要验证所需带宽时,可以参考下列公式:
单帧大小(MB)=(垂直线*水平线*色位*交叉因子)/(8388608比特/ MB)
其中逐行扫描时交叉因子为1,隔行扫描时为0.5。
近似带宽=单帧大小*帧数/s
注意,三通道彩色图像的色位恒为32,数字视频的色位为标准8位色深或10位、12位色深,其中12位色深的数据会被按位打包成32位。
表1 常见数字视频分辨率的近似使用带宽
**这个值非常接近实际PXIe x1系统的200MB/s带宽限制。 | |||||||
名称 | 纵向线 | 横向线 | 帧/s | 色位 | 单帧大小(MB) | 近似带宽(MB/s) | PXIe x1 理论是否可以通过? |
---|---|---|---|---|---|---|---|
1080p 60Hz | 1920 | 1080 | 60 | 32 | 7.91 | 475 | 否 |
1080p 30Hz | 1920 | 1080 | 30 | 32 | 7.91 | 237 | 否 |
1080p 24Hz | 1920 | 1080 | 24 | 32 | 7.91 | 190 | 是** |
1080i 60Hz | 1920 | 1080 | 60 | 32 | 3.95 | 237 | 否 |
1080i 30Hz | 1920 | 1080 | 30 | 32 | 3.95 | 119 | 是 |
1080i 24Hz | 1920 | 1080 | 24 | 32 | 3.95 | 95 | 是 |
720p 60Hz | 1280 | 720 | 60 | 32 | 3.51 | 211 | 否 |
720p 30Hz | 1280 | 720 | 30 | 32 | 3.51 | 105 | 是 |
720p 24Hz | 1280 | 720 | 24 | 32 | 3.51 | 84 | 是 |
720i 60Hz | 1280 | 720 | 60 | 32 | 1.76 | 105 | 是 |
720i 30Hz | 1280 | 720 | 30 | 32 | 1.76 | 53 | 是 |
720i 24Hz | 1280 | 720 | 24 | 32 | 1.76 | 42 | 是 |
480p 60Hz | 640 | 480 | 60 | 32 | 1.17 | 70 | 是 |
480p 30Hz | 640 | 480 | 30 | 32 | 1.17 | 35 | 是 |
480p 24Hz | 640 | 480 | 24 | 32 | 1.17 | 28 | 是 |
480i 60Hz | 640 | 480 | 60 | 32 | 0.59 | 35 | 是 |
480i 30Hz | 640 | 480 | 30 | 32 | 0.59 | 18 | 是 |
480i 24Hz | 640 | 480 | 24 | 32 | 0.59 | 14 | 是 |
表中列出的近似带宽仅表示视频活动帧所需的带宽。White Paper: Under the Hood of the NI PXIe-1491 讨论了满足实际视频流传输所需的PXIe背板带宽能力的其他决定因素。
表中最后一列给出了x1链理论上是否满足各分辨率所需的带宽,便于选择适合数字视频采集的PXIe机箱和控制器。 此外,其他因素也会影响测试系统处理高带宽的能力。有关PXIe x1系统或处理能力不足对系统性能的影响,可以参考KnowledgeBase 6F7CAFPC: Recommended PXIe Chassis and Controllers for Digital Video Acquisition。
|